Enum xmc4200::gpdma0_ch0::cfgh::FCMODE_A

source ·
pub enum FCMODE_A {
    VALUE1 = 0,
    VALUE2 = 1,
}
Expand description

Flow Control Mode

Value on reset: 0

Variants§

§

VALUE1 = 0

0: Source transaction requests are serviced when they occur. Data pre-fetching is enabled.

§

VALUE2 = 1

1: Source transaction requests are not serviced until a destination transaction request occurs. In this mode, the amount of data transferred from the source is limited so that it is guaranteed to be transferred to the destination prior to block termination by the destination. Data pre-fetching is disabled.
